#597067 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#597067 is composed of 34.9% red, 43.9% green and 40.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 8%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 156.5 degrees, a saturation of 11.4% and a lightness of 39.4%. #597067 color hex could be obtained by blending #b2e0ce with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#597067

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020302 is the darkest color, while #f7f8f8 is the lightest one.
